Abstract
We present the results of an exact analysis of a model energy landscape of a protein to clarify the notion of the transition state and the physical meaning of the values determined in protein engineering experiments. We benchmark our findings to various theoretical approaches proposed in the literature for the identification and characterization of the transition state.
